本文目录导读:
随着互联网的快速发展,服务器作为承载网站、应用、数据等核心资源的载体,其性能和稳定性越来越受到重视,在众多服务器中,如何进行优化,以提高其运行效率、降低成本、保障安全,成为了一个亟待解决的问题,本文将从多个角度出发,为您详细解析高效服务器优化策略。
硬件优化
1、选择合适的硬件配置
服务器硬件配置是决定其性能的关键因素,在选择服务器硬件时,应考虑以下因素:
图片来源于网络,如有侵权联系删除
(1)CPU:根据应用需求选择合适的CPU型号,确保足够的处理能力。
(2)内存:根据应用需求增加内存容量,提高数据处理速度。
(3)硬盘:选择高速、大容量的硬盘,如SSD,以提高读写速度。
(4)网络设备:选择高性能、稳定的网络设备,确保网络传输速度。
2、硬件散热
服务器在工作过程中会产生大量热量,若散热不良,会导致硬件性能下降甚至损坏,应确保服务器具备良好的散热系统,如风扇、散热片等。
软件优化
1、操作系统优化
(1)选择合适的操作系统:根据应用需求选择稳定的操作系统,如Linux、Windows等。
(2)系统参数调整:合理调整系统参数,如CPU使用率、内存分配等,以提高系统性能。
(3)系统更新:定期更新操作系统,修复漏洞,提高安全性。
图片来源于网络,如有侵权联系删除
2、应用软件优化
(1)合理配置应用软件:根据应用需求调整软件参数,如线程数、连接数等。
(2)代码优化:优化代码,减少资源占用,提高运行效率。
(3)数据库优化:对数据库进行索引、分区等优化,提高查询速度。
网络优化
1、网络带宽
根据应用需求选择合适的网络带宽,确保网络传输速度。
2、网络协议
选择合适的网络协议,如TCP、UDP等,根据应用场景进行优化。
3、负载均衡
采用负载均衡技术,将请求分配到多个服务器,提高整体性能。
图片来源于网络,如有侵权联系删除
安全优化
1、防火墙
部署防火墙,防止恶意攻击,保障服务器安全。
2、安全审计
定期进行安全审计,发现并修复安全隐患。
3、数据备份
定期备份数据,防止数据丢失。
服务器优化是一个系统工程,涉及硬件、软件、网络、安全等多个方面,通过以上策略,可以有效地提高服务器性能、降低成本、保障安全,在实际操作中,应根据具体情况进行调整,以达到最佳效果。
标签: #服务器如何做优化
评论列表